Establishing a Realistic Budget



When preparing your wedding celebration, it's vital to develop a sensible budget for booking a place. Setting a budget plan early on will certainly aid you limit your alternatives and stop you from falling in love with a place that's way out of your cost range. Begin by identifying just how much you can afford to designate towards the place while keeping in mind other costs like event catering, decorations, and amusement.

Research study different places in your preferred place to get an idea of their price arrays. Bear in mind that venues frequently have different rates rates depending on the day of the week, time of year, and time of day. Make sure to ask about any additional fees or requirements, such as a minimal visitor count or necessary vendors.

When you have a mutual understanding of the costs involved, produce a detailed budget plan that allots a realistic amount for the venue. Keep in mind to leave some wiggle space for unexpected expenditures that might develop.

Considering Place Capability



To successfully think about place ability, assess the variety of visitors you prepare to welcome and guarantee the location can comfortably fit them. The last point you want is for your visitors to feel cramped or for the venue to feel empty.

Take into consideration the format of the room also - elements like seating setups, dance flooring size, and any kind of added areas you might need for activities or solutions. Remember that while a venue may mention an optimum capacity, it's important to also consider how this will certainly impact the overall comfort and flow of your event.

It's necessary to have a clear concept of your guest checklist at an early stage in the preparation process to make educated choices regarding the location. Bear in mind that you may require a slightly bigger ability than your guest count to enable suppliers, staff, and any kind of unforeseen plus ones.

Clarifying Agreement Terms



Guarantee you thoroughly understand all the terms detailed in the place contract before completing your reservation. This action is important in avoiding any type of misunderstandings or unexpected prices later. Put in the time to very carefully evaluate each condition, paying attention to the termination policy, payment schedule, and any possible extra costs.

When making clear contract terms, do not wait to ask concerns if something is vague. Look for clarification on areas such as what's consisted of in the rental charge, any limitations on suppliers, arrangement and failure times, and whether there are noise restrictions or time limits.

See to it all verbal agreements are likewise documented in the contract to prevent any type of conflicts down the line.

Any type of changes or enhancements to the contract terms need to be clearly described and agreed upon by both parties before signing.
